ALAMO, Nev. (KOLO) - The Nevada Department of Wildlife is looking for two people accused of illegally dumping turkeys in eastern Nevada.
NDOW says the pair dumped around 25 turkeys onto the Key Pittman Wildlife Management Area, around 110 miles north of Las Vegas, on April 9.
Game Wardens were called to that area and found them dumped at the south end of Nesbit Lake on the Wildlife Management Area. The wardens were able to find a witness who told them they saw a white truck with a crew cab...

NV has almost more Wild Horses and Burros combined than our struggling Mule Deer Herd that is almost at a all time low very sad situation indeed.
From 2020 to 2023, the U.S. Bureau of Land Management (BLM) rounded up and removed 50,000 wild horses and burros, primarily in Nevada.
The BLM said Monday it estimates the current population in the state at 38,023 — 33,338 horses and 4,685 burros. Overall, the population on all public lands across the country is estimated at 73,520, a decline...
